When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ired

Is the level of convenience in your home dis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if neglected, could result in more severe repair work or the need for an early replacement of your ac system. While a unit that will not turn on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you recognize with the more subtle indicators of a issue with your air conditioning, you will have the ability to contact a professional service specialist quicker rather than later on.

If any of the following apply, one of our Missouri AC repair professionals encourages that you give us a call:

  • You are incurring an increase in the quantity of cash needed to spend for your monthly utility bills: Inefficient operation of your a/c can be brought on by a number of various issues, including leaking 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a faulty thermostat. This indicates that it needs to work more difficult to keep your home cool, which will lead to a considerable boost in the quantity that you pay in energy expenses.
  • You just see h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, ensure you haven’t accidentally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by examining it. If that is not the case, then you more than likely have a issue on the within your air conditioning unit, and you must get it examined by a expert.
  • You are seeing a higher hum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the primary function of your a/c unit, it is accountable for managing the humidity level inside of your home or industrial structure. Higher humidity suggests that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can result in the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is necessary that you get this matter fixed as quickly as humanly possible, especially for the sake of your safety.
  • The air flow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ide variety of factors that can result in inadequate airflow. We will need to carry out a detailed evaluation in order to determine whether the problem is the result of a clogged air filter, an concern with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or blocked duct.
  • You observe that there is a significant quantity of wetness in the area around your system: Condensation is a natural incident, nevertheless it shouldn’t be present in excessive qu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a blocked drain tube if you notice any excess moisture or pooling water in the area.
  • Odd Noises from Your Unit: It is to be anticipated for an a/c to create some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ible screeching,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an apparent sign that something requires to be fixed.
  • It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your air conditioner. If you have hot and cold areas around your home, your system will not shut off, or it won’t start,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at. If your unit won’t begin, it could likewise be due to the fact that it will not shut off.
  • Foul odors are coming from your system: There may be a problem with your a/c if you smell anything burning or a musty smell. These smells can be brought on by a range of elements, consisting of mold development and charred wiring.
  • Your system rotates frequently in between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have selected on the thermostat, a/c unit are configured to turn off immediately. Regardless of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ises

There are a few sounds that must not be heard coming from air conditioning unit although they do not operate completely sil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a shrieking to a grinding to a clicking sound. These particular sounds almost always show that there is a issue within the a/c system that has to be repaired by a expert of in Jackson County.

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ioner The following need to be consisted of:

  • Banging: The issue is normally the compressor in an ac system that is making a banging sound. This component of the air conditioning unit is accountable for providing refrigerant to the different other components of the system in order to remove excess heat from your home. Compressor elements might loosen up as the AC system ages. This noise is caused by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
  • Shrieking: A damaged blower fan motor within the a/c unit may produce a sound similar to shrieking or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Typically, a malfunctioning f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Switch off the air conditioner right away and connect with a professional for repair work whenever you hear a screeching noise.
  •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never a good sign to hear originating from any sort of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or may have worn out, which may lead to this grinding noise originating from the air conditioner.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ally suggests that the compressor itself has to be replaced. The complete a/c unit might need to be replaced depending upon the model of a/c and how old it is.
  • Clicking: It is very common for an air conditioner to make a clicking sound when it initially swit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ole period of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working properly.
